Gnus, nazwy, podpakiety i konflikt info z Emacsem
Maciek Pasternacki
maciekp w japhy.fnord.org
Czw, 22 Kwi 2004, 22:48:58 CEST
On Pungenday, Discord 40, 3170 YOLD, Paweł Gołaszewski wrote:
>> Próbuję przepakietować bieżącego Gnusa (5.10.6) i nawet jakoś to
>> wychodzi, ale mam z tym parę problemów.
>>
>> Największym jest konflikt plików info; GNU Emacs zawiera Gnusa z
>> przyległymi bibliotekami we wcześniejszej wersji.
>
> Po co on tam jest?
> Nie wystarczy nowsza wersja?
Starsza seria jest rozprowadzana jako część Emacsa (razem z samym
Emacsem, ten sam tarball źródłowy). W zasadzie jest częścią edytora.
>> Czy żeby nie konfliktować, muszę przekopać spece Emacsa i wyrzucić
>> starego Gnusa do podpakietu, który by z moim Gnusem konfliktował jako
>> całość (tudzież: Conflicts: czy Obsoletes: w takim przypadku?), czy jest
>> jakaś prostsza metoda radzenia sobie z takimi sytuacjami?
>
> Jest.
> Olewamy starszą wersję (rm -rf) i dostarczamy tylko jedną.
To z kolei psuje zachowanie Emacsa -- bieżąca wersja mocno inaczej
traktuje konfigi chociażby (to nie jest nowsza wersja, tylko następna
seria). Jeśli to jest faktycznie właściwe wyjście, nie jest problemem
dystrybuowanie Emacsa okrojonego o części, których nowsze wersje są
dystrybuowane oddzielnie, mi to nie przeszkadza w żaden sposób, bo
i tak starego nie używam, ale nie można mieć pewności, że całkowite
usunięcie Gnusa nikomu nic nie popsuje.
BTW, w cvsowej wersji speca w TODO jest właśnie zrobienie podpakietu:
# TODO:
# - move gnus*.info to separate package (conflict with xemacs-gnus-info-pkg)
Generalnie w najbliższym czasie mogę pobawić się w psucie pakietowania
Emacsa i zobaczenie, czy da się go bezkonfliktowo rozbić/pookrajać.
Pytanie jeszcze, czy system nazywania, jaki tutaj przyjąłem, jest dobry;
generalnie jest sporo pakietów, które można budować i dla GNU Emacsa,
i dla XEmacsa (dodatkowe tryby, w3, bbdb, takie tam) i w miarę czasu
chciałbym porobić pakiety z co przydatniejszymi.
Pozdrawiam,
--dżaf.
--
__ Maciek Pasternacki <maciekp w japhy.fnord.org> [ http://japhy.fnord.org/ ]
`| _ |_\ / { ...i choćby nie wiem, kto, i choćby nie wiem, jak, próbował
,|{-}|}| }\/ wrednie ci nakłamać -- nie wolno wierzyć ci, że nie ma czasu,
\/ |____/ a jedzenie i seks to to samo... } ( W. Waglewski ) -><-
-------------- następna część ---------
Załącznik, który nie był tekstem został usunięty...
Name: nie znany
Type: application/pgp-signature
Size: 188 bytes
Desc: nie znany
Url : /mailman/pipermail/pld-devel-pl/attachments/20040626/e05652c0/attachment.bin
Więcej informacji o liście dyskusyjnej pld-devel-pl